Description
Transform your turkey leftovers into a delicious ramen bowl. This recipe is quick, easy, and packed with flavor.
Ingredients
- 2 cups turkey leftovers, shredded
- 4 cups chicken or turkey broth
- 2 packs ramen noodles (seasoning packets optional)
- 1 tbsp soy sauce
- 1 tsp sesame oil
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 1 green onion, sliced
- 1 soft-boiled egg (optional)
- 1/2 cup spinach or bok choy
Instructions
- Heat broth in a pot over medium heat.
- Add shredded turkey, soy sauce, sesame oil, and garlic. Simmer for 5 minutes.
- Cook ramen noodles separately according to package instructions. Drain.
- Divide noodles between two bowls. Pour hot broth and turkey over noodles.
- Top with spinach or bok choy, green onions, and a soft-boiled egg if desired.
- Serve immediately.
Notes
- Use leftover vegetables for extra flavor.
- Adjust soy sauce to taste.
- For spicier ramen, add chili oil or sriracha.
